About Humboldt County
Humboldt County is located in California and contains 38 ZIP codes across 35 cities and communities.
The county's population was 136,310 as of 2021,
an increase of
1.3% from 134,623 in 2010.
The timezone is Alaska Time (observes DST).
The Federal Information Processing System (FIPS) code for Humboldt County is 06023.
